Mercedes go conservative with Mexican Grand Prix tyre choices

Mercedes have opted for a conservative tyre strategy for the Mexican Grand Prix, with the 2016 championship winning team selecting just five sets of the supersoft tyre for each of its drivers Nico Rosberg and Lewis Hamilton. The pair have selected different amounts of the soft and medium, with Rosberg taking one more of the medium than Hamilton. Meanwhile their nearest rivals, Red Bull and Ferrari, have six of the supersoft for each of its drivers. Red Bull's Max Verstappen and Daniel Ricciardo will have four sets of the soft and three of the medium, the same as Ferrari's Sebastian Vettel, whilst Kimi Raikkonen has an extra set of the softs.
